This manual provides detailed instructions for the diymore ESP32-S3 DevKitC-1 N16R8 Development Module. It covers hardware features, setup procedures, operational guidelines, and technical specifications to assist users in developing applications with this powerful microcontroller.

The ESP32-S3 is a highly integrated, low-power 2.4 GHz Wi-Fi and Bluetooth 5 (LE) dual-core microcontroller. It features a Xtensa LX7 dual-core 32-bit processor, up to 240 MHz clock frequency, 512KB SRAM, and extensive GPIO pins. It supports Octal SPI flash and high-capacity off-chip RAM, making it suitable for a wide range of IoT and embedded applications.

2.1 Components clau

  • ESP32-S3-WROOM-1 Module: The core module containing the ESP32-S3 chip, providing Wi-Fi and Bluetooth connectivity.
  • Ports USB tipus C: Two USB-C ports are available. One for USB to Serial Port (CH343P) and another for ESP32-S3 Pass-Through USB & OTG functionality. Both can be used for program downloading.
  • Botó RST: Reset button for the module.
  • Botó d'arrencada: Boot mode selection button, typically used during firmware flashing.
  • Power Chip: Manages power supply to the module.
  • Integrated RGB-LED Module: A programmable RGB LED for status indication or user feedback.
  • Indicadors LED: PWR (Power), TX (Transmit), and RX (Receive) LEDs to indicate module status and data transmission.

6. Configuració i programació

To begin using your ESP32-S3 DevKitC-1 N16R8 module, you will need to set up your development environment and upload firmware.

6.1 Connexió del mòdul

  1. Connect the ESP32-S3 module to your computer using a USB Type-C cable. You can use either of the two USB-C ports on the board.
  2. Ensure that the necessary drivers for the USB-to-serial chip (CH343P) are installed on your computer. These drivers are typically available from the chip manufacturer's website or your operating system's default driver repository.

6.2 Càrrega de firmware

The ESP32-S3 supports two primary methods for uploading program files (firmware):

  • Direct USB Port: Firmware can be downloaded directly via the ESP32's native USB port.
  • Integrated USB-to-Serial Port: Alternatively, the integrated hardware USB-to-serial port can be used for downloading.

In a Windows environment, you can use the official Espressif flash_download_tool_xxx software for flashing firmware. For other operating systems, tools like Esptool.py are commonly used.

Before uploading, you may need to press and hold the BARRETA , premeu i deixeu anar el botó RST button, and finally release the BARRETA button to put the module into download mode.

7.1 Connectivitat Wi-Fi i Bluetooth

  • The module supports Wi-Fi 802.11 b/g/n and Bluetooth 5.0 (LE).
  • Its Bluetooth Low Energy subsystem supports Bluetooth 5 (LE) and Bluetooth Mesh.
  • Equipped with a low-power coprocessor and a high-power mode up to 20 dBm, it can meet various application scenarios.
  • Supports WMM, A-MPDU, A-MSDU, immediate block acknowledgment, and other functions to improve multitasking efficiency.

9. Solució De Problemes

  • Module not recognized by computer: Ensure USB Type-C cable is functional and correctly connected. Verify that the USB-to-serial drivers (e.g., CH343P) are installed. Try a different USB port or computer.
  • Firmware upload failure: Confirm the module is in download mode (press BOOT, then RST, release RST, then release BOOT). Check your development environment settings (e.g., correct COM port, baud rate). Ensure the firmware file és vàlid.
  • Problemes de connectivitat Wi-Fi/Bluetooth: Check antenna connection (if external). Verify Wi-Fi credentials and network availability. Ensure Bluetooth device is discoverable and within range. Review your code for correct initialization and connection procedures.
  • Comportament inesperat: This could be due to software bugs or hardware issues. Review your code logic. Check power supply stability. Consult online forums or the Espressif documentation for common issues related to ESP32-S3.
